ARM Holdings plc, the licensor of processors and related intellectual property, has tipped sparse details of plans for a next-generation processor to follow on to the three processor cores that comprise the Cortex series. According to the source, the processor will remain with the current instruction set architecture as Cortex processors and it would take about 18 months for the design to complete and come to silicon.

In January 2006 Warren East, chief executive officer of ARM, hinted that a multiprocessing version of one of ARMs Cortex series processors could be in design. Cortex is the follow-on processor range to the ARM11 series of cores, which includes the ARM11 MPcore, a four-way SMP implementation of the ARM11 processor core. However, since then little has been heard about a multiprocessing Cortex processor.
